8 - Remote operation The DM-3200 is capable of acting as a remote control unit for a wide variety of external devices. The exact functionality of the machine control depends, of course, on the device to be controlled. The device control is carried out through the MIDI connections, including the USB MIDI ports (for MMC), or the serial port via P2 protocol (RS-422). Different devices can be selected for simultaneous control by the DM-3200, with different devices being controlled in different ways. For instance, it is possible to select one device to have its transport functions controlled by the DM-3200, while the DM-3200 controls the track arming functions of another device. NOTE In this section, the term "controller" is used to refer to a part of the DM-3200 software controlling an external device, rather than a hardware feature of the device or the DM-3200.
